El 22/5/25 a las 9:11, Martin Neitzel escribió:
>>     Hi, just to share it, I found sysinst a bit dangerous when I was very
>>     very novice in NetBSD. Trying to install sets from sysinst I ended
>>     overwriting /etc/.
> 
> That's the distinction between "a" and "b" on the initial "sysinst"
> dialog box:
> 
>                 │ a: Install NetBSD to hard disk                │
>                 │ b: Upgrade NetBSD on a hard disk              │
>                 │ c: Re-install sets or install additional sets │
> 
> "a" overwrites everything, also with the "etc" set, "b" will
> run you through merge actions instead.
> 
> For the extra X11 sets, the proper choice is ofcourse "c".
> 
> 							Martin

Thanks Martin for clarifying it. I do not remember exactly what I was 
trying to do that day. Perhaps it was "c" and I marked everything cause 
I thought: "yes, I want all the sets".  :-)
